Rumah >pembangunan bahagian belakang >tutorial php >Bagaimana untuk menggunakan PHP untuk membangunkan fungsi pesanan makan di dalam sistem pesanan makanan?

Bagaimana untuk menggunakan PHP untuk membangunkan fungsi pesanan makan di dalam sistem pesanan makanan?

WBOY
WBOYasal
2023-11-01 10:04:551131semak imbas

Bagaimana untuk menggunakan PHP untuk membangunkan fungsi pesanan makan di dalam sistem pesanan makanan?

Sistem pesanan adalah sistem yang digunakan secara meluas di restoran makanan segera, restoran dan pertubuhan katering lain Ia boleh meningkatkan kecekapan, mengurangkan pesanan yang tidak dijawab, memudahkan pelanggan, meningkatkan imej restoran, dll. PHP ialah bahasa skrip bahagian pelayan yang digunakan secara meluas Menggunakan PHP untuk membangunkan sistem pesanan makanan boleh meningkatkan kestabilan, skalabiliti dan keselamatan sistem. Artikel ini memperkenalkan cara menggunakan PHP untuk membangunkan fungsi pesanan makan di dalam sistem pesanan makanan.

1. pesanan dan Kaedah memesan makanan yang dihantar ke meja pelanggan. Isu utama yang perlu dipertimbangkan semasa membangunkan sistem pesanan makan masuk termasuk paparan bahagian hadapan, struktur hidangan, proses data pesanan dan pembayaran.

2. Paparan bahagian hadapan

Paparan bahagian hadapan sistem pesanan makan di dalam dibahagikan kepada dua bahagian: menu pesanan dan troli beli-belah. Menu pesanan perlu dikelaskan mengikut kategori hidangan, dan label ditetapkan untuk setiap kategori bagi memudahkan pelanggan mencari dan memilih hidangan. Setiap hidangan boleh memaparkan nama hidangan, gambar, harga, rasa dan maklumat lain Pelanggan boleh menetapkan bilangan hidangan dengan mengklik butang "+" dan "-". Secara umumnya, troli beli-belah perlu memaparkan senarai, kuantiti dan harga subjumlah hidangan yang dipilih, dan juga menyokong operasi seperti mengubah suai kuantiti dan memadamkan hidangan.

3. Struktur hidangan

Struktur hidangan terutamanya merujuk kepada struktur data hidangan dan klasifikasi hidangan. Struktur data hidangan secara amnya termasuk ID hidangan, nama, gambar, harga, rasa, keterangan dan maklumat lain, yang akan disimpan dalam pangkalan data. Klasifikasi hidangan biasanya dibahagikan kepada kategori besar dan kategori kecil Kategori besar boleh menjadi masakan, ramuan, fungsi, dll., dan kategori kecil boleh menjadi hidangan panas, hidangan sejuk, sup, dll. Adalah disyorkan untuk mengabstrak struktur hidangan dan kaedah klasifikasi ke dalam model data untuk memudahkan pengembangan dan penyelenggaraan seterusnya.

4. Proses data pesanan

Proses data pesanan terutamanya termasuk langkah-langkah juruwang membuat pesanan, penyediaan dapur, pelayan menghantar makanan, dll. Dalam proses pesanan, anda boleh menanyakan maklumat hidangan dan menjana pesanan dengan menyambung ke pangkalan data Selepas pesanan dijana, maklumat berkaitan pesanan disimpan dalam pangkalan data, termasuk ID pesanan, masa pesanan, jumlah pembayaran, nombor jadual. dan maklumat lain. Proses pengeluaran perlu menanyakan maklumat hidangan daripada pangkalan data mengikut maklumat pesanan dan membuat hidangan, dan menghantar hidangan yang disediakan ke meja yang sepadan. Proses penghantaran makanan perlu memadankan maklumat tempahan pelanggan dengan maklumat pengeluaran dapur bagi memastikan hidangan yang dihantar ke meja adalah konsisten dengan tempahan pelanggan.

5. Pembayaran

Pautan pembayaran adalah salah satu pautan terpenting dalam sistem pesanan makan di dalam, dan keselamatan dan kemudahan proses pembayaran perlu dipastikan. Kaedah pembayaran biasanya termasuk pembayaran tunai, pembayaran mesin POS, pembayaran WeChat/Alipay, dll. Pembayaran WeChat/Alipay memerlukan penggunaan platform pembayaran pihak ketiga. Pautan pembayaran perlu merekodkan maklumat seperti jumlah pembayaran, status pembayaran, masa pembayaran, dsb., dan pada masa yang sama, adalah perlu untuk memastikan konsistensi data berinteraksi dengan bahagian hadapan.

6. Rumusan

Pembangunan sistem tempahan makan di dalam perlu mengambil kira paparan bahagian hadapan, struktur hidangan, proses data pesanan dan pembayaran, antaranya pembayaran adalah salah satu pautan yang paling penting. Pembangunan sistem boleh dijalankan dengan bantuan PHP dan rangka kerja serta komponen yang berkaitan. Sistem pesanan makan di dalam boleh meningkatkan kecekapan pesanan pelanggan, mengurangkan beban kerja pelayan, mengurangkan kadar pesanan yang tidak dijawab, dan meningkatkan imej restoran.

Atas ialah kandungan terperinci Bagaimana untuk menggunakan PHP untuk membangunkan fungsi pesanan makan di dalam sistem pesanan makanan?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n